Grants of up to EUR 100,000 for projects of strengthening of EU integration in Serbia, Macedonia and Montenegro

The general goal of this call is to contribute to democratic consolidation, institutional reforms and permanent peace and stability in Macedonia, Montenegro and Serbia, through supporting OCD initiatives pertaining to the EU integration process, focusing on specific negotiation chapters, namely: Chapter 5 – Public Procurement, Chapter 8 – Competition Policy, Chapter 23 – Judiciary and Fundamental Rights, Chapter 24 – Justice, Freedom and Security, Chapter 32 – Financial Control and Chapter 35 – Other Issues: Relations with Kosovo (Serbia only).
As said, individual grants will be allocated in the amounts of 25,000 to 100,000 euros, and civil society organizations from Macedonia, Montenegro and Serbia may apply.
The project execution period is 12 months, and the contest is open throughout the year.
